2013-06-26 33 views
-1

我對錶達式引擎CMS非常陌生,我不知道如何讓我的插件代碼在文章中工作。表達式引擎插件內部文章

當嵌入到模板中時,它的工作效果很好,但是當我嘗試在文章中放入相同的代碼時,它只會將其呈現爲文本。

模板嵌入:http://ee.o7th.com/

條嵌入:http://ee.o7th.com/index.php/about

你可以看到在第二環節的嵌入代碼。但對於那些誰在這裏需要它,它很簡單:

{exp:o7thpdfembed form="hpAXWPa7ol*ucBDOxbinuA" id="Test-Form-Container-ID" class="Test-Form-Container-Class" style="height:800px;width:100%;overflow:auto;"} 
This will be the files title. 
{/exp:o7thpdfembed} 
+0

我假設我需要使用'全局變量',但是,我該如何傳遞所需的參數? – Kevin

+0

因此,您的插件被稱爲「o7thpdfembed」?什麼是文章?我們需要查看您的模板代碼以獲得幫助,如果它與您的插件相關,則需要該代碼(或部分代碼)。但從根本上說,我會建議退一步,如果你能解釋你想要達到什麼目的,爲什麼你寫了一個插件? –

+0

我寫了一個插件,因爲我的客戶端需要動態的方式來傳遞文件ID,並將PDF嵌入到頁面中。現在,通過上面的代碼嵌入到模板中時,該插件可以很好地工作。但是,當我嘗試將相同的代碼放入文章/條目/內容頁面(無論他們稱之爲什麼)時,它顯示的只是上面的代碼,而不是渲染 – Kevin

回答

0

解決的辦法是找到一個噩夢,因爲它似乎無法在EE文檔中記錄任何地方,也不是我能在網上找到關於它的任何東西。

條目無法解析除定製模板Global Variables以外的任何EE代碼。這讓我想...

我安裝了一個叫做允許EE代碼插件,放在適當的標籤{exp:allow_eecode}在我的模板{body}標籤,然後能夠利用和運行條目中的問題的代碼